The surname Lopes Fernandes is a common surname found in several countries around the world. It is a combination of two surnames, "Lopes" and "Fernandes", which are both of Portuguese origin. In this article, we will explore the history and significance of the surname Lopes Fernandes, as well as its distribution in different countries.
The surname Lopes Fernandes can be traced back to Portugal, where both "Lopes" and "Fernandes" are common surnames. "Lopes" is derived from the Portuguese word for wolf, while "Fernandes" is a patronymic surname meaning "son of Fernando".
